School Food Waste
Composting and Reusables Program

Our school food waste composting program is in its fifth year and going strong. In addition to running our full compost program at five schools, we have also added a reusables pilot program, in partnership with EcoLab Hawaii, at our flagship school, Lahaina Intermediate. The 2022/23 school year we successfully diverted over 93,000 lbs of food from the landfill, bringing our program total to over 120,000 lbs of food waste diverted and composted!

We are looking to grow this program exponentially to divert as much waste as possible from our central Maui landfill, and teach our keiki to view food scraps as a resource.
